Over the next two (possibly three) episodes, you'll hear excerpts of the “State and the Future of AxonIQ” presentation presented at AxonIQCon22 by CTO Allard Buijze and other colleagues.
This presentation highlighted the changes within AxonIQ as a company and a team, as well as the products in the past two years and moving forward.
In this first portion of the talk, Allard spoke about our company and our team and some of the changes that we have gone through in recent years. He spoke of our passions, our goals, and what binds us all together.
After that, Milen Dyankov spoke on what our Developer Relations team has been up to. He highlighted some important items on Axon Academy, Discuss platform, our website, and the ways the community can interact with us and our community. He also spoke about how everyone can contribute to our products and make suggestions and requests for new features and improvements.
